Throughout our admissions process, you’ll have various touchpoints to see our classrooms, meet our team and watch your child interact with the Happy Day environment.
Our admissions policy prioritizes siblings of current students and children of alumni. As a diverse school community, we also participate in the Massachusetts State voucher program on a limited basis.

Tuition
Our tuition rates for the 2025-2026 school year are below, along with information about registration fees and deposits. We offer flexible care options for families that include 3, 4 or 5 days a week and half-day or full-day schedules. Many Happy Day families have multiple children at the school, and we offer an 8% discount for siblings.
